Seiya Inoue
Japanese baseball player (born 1989) From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Seiya Inoue (井上 晴哉, Inoue Seiya; born July 3, 1989), nicknamed "Aja",[1] is a Japanese former professional baseball infielder. He played in Nippon Professional Baseball (NPB) from 2014 to 2024 for the Chiba Lotte Marines.

Career
Inoue played parts of 10 seasons in Nippon Professional Baseball from 2014 to 2014 for the Chiba Lotte Marines. Playing in 601 total games, he batted .250/.340/.417 with 76 home runs and 313 RBI. On October 22, 2024, Inoue announced his retirement from professional baseball.[2]
